The baby name Amaryllis is a girl name, 4 syllables long and is pronounced "Uh-MARE-uh-liss".
Amaryllis is Greek in Origin.
Amaryllis is a feminine given name that has Greek origins. The name is derived from the Greek word "amarysso," which means "to sparkle." In Greek mythology, Amaryllis was a beautiful nymph who fell in love with a shepherd named Alteo. She tried to win his love by piercing her heart with a golden arrow every day for a month, and on the last day, a beautiful flower grew from her blood. This flower was named Amaryllis in her honor.
The name Amaryllis has been used as a given name since the 19th century. It gained popularity in the United States in the 1920s and 1930s, but it has never been a very common name. Amaryllis is often associated with the flower of the same name, which is known for its striking beauty and vibrant colors. The flower is often used in floral arrangements and is a popular gift during the holiday season.
